Ghost Integration

Connect your Ghost blog with Rank Sector for automated content publishing.

How Ghost Integration Works

The Rank Sector Ghost integration uses Ghost's Admin API to publish articles directly to your Ghost blog. Once configured with your Ghost API credentials, Rank Sector can create and manage posts on your Ghost site with full HTML content, featured images, tags, and metadata.

Setup Instructions

Step 1: Navigate to Ghost Integrations

Log in to your Ghost Admin panel. Go to Settings → Integrations and scroll down to the Advanced section. This is where you will create a custom integration for Rank Sector.

Step 2: Create Custom Integration

Click "Add custom integration" in the Advanced section. Name the integration "Rank Sector" and click "Add" to create it.

Step 3: Copy API Credentials

After creating the integration, Ghost will display your API credentials. You will need:

  • Content API Key — Used for reading public content
  • Admin API Key — Used for creating and managing posts (this is the key you need for Rank Sector)
  • API URL — Your Ghost site's API endpoint (e.g., https://your-site.ghost.io)
Make sure to copy the Admin API Key, not the Content API Key. The Admin API Key is required for Rank Sector to create posts on your Ghost site.

Step 4: Configure Rank Sector Integration

In your Rank Sector dashboard, navigate to Integrations and select Ghost. Paste your Admin API Key and API URL into the designated fields. Click "Test Connection" to verify that Rank Sector can communicate with your Ghost site.

Step 5: Publish Articles

Once connected, configure your preferred publishing settings:

  • Publishing status — Choose whether articles are published as draft or published on Ghost
  • Default tags — Set default tags that will be applied to all articles sent from Rank Sector

Your integration is now complete. Articles generated in Rank Sector will be automatically sent to your Ghost blog based on your configuration.

What Gets Published

When you publish an article through Rank Sector, the following data is sent to your Ghost blog:

  • Article title
  • Full HTML content
  • Featured image
  • Meta data (meta title and description)
  • Tags
  • Publication status (draft or published)

Troubleshooting

API key not accepted

Ensure you are using the Admin API Key, not the Content API Key. The Admin API Key is longer and is required for write operations. You can find both keys in Ghost Admin under Settings → Integrations → Rank Sector.

Unable to connect

Verify that your Ghost API URL is in the correct format. It should be your Ghost site's base URL without a trailing slash (e.g., https://your-site.ghost.io). Ensure your Ghost site is accessible from the internet and not behind a firewall that blocks API requests.

Images not appearing

Verify that your image URLs are publicly accessible. Ghost requires that featured images and inline images are hosted at publicly reachable URLs. If you are using a self-hosted Ghost instance, ensure your image storage is properly configured.

Keep your Admin API Key secure and never share it publicly. If you suspect your key has been compromised, regenerate it immediately from your Ghost Admin integrations page.
